Job description
Overview

A prestigious private game reserve in Limpopo is seeking a passionate, motivated, and hands-on Junior Project Site Manager (Construction) to join its development team. This is an exciting opportunity for an energetic and technically skilled professional to gain experience in a unique environment, overseeing construction projects that blend modern functionality with the natural beauty of the African bush. The role requires a balance of technical expertise, strong leadership skills, and the ability to manage projects from start to finish while ensuring quality, safety, and timely delivery.

Key Responsibilities

Project Planning & Coordination

  • Develop, implement, and monitor project schedules.
  • Oversee multiple tasks and priorities to ensure timely completion.
  • Ensure accurate interpretation of construction plans and specifications.
  • Procure and manage materials for each phase of the project.

Leadership & People Management

  • Supervise construction workers and subcontractors.
  • Delegate tasks effectively, ensuring balanced workload distribution.
  • Foster a motivated and productive work environment.
  • Communicate project updates and expectations clearly to all team members.

Operational Excellence

  • Ensure compliance with building codes, safety regulations, and best practices.
  • Conduct regular safety inspections and enforce safety protocols.
  • Oversee quality control and ensure workmanship meets required standards.
  • Solve day-to-day challenges promptly to keep the project on track.

Financial & Resource Management

  • Monitor and control budgets to ensure projects remain within financial constraints.
  • Identify cost-saving opportunities without compromising quality.
  • Manage company vehicles and construction equipment effectively.

Adaptability & Problem-Solving

  • Adjust plans to accommodate changing circumstances and unexpected challenges.
  • Demonstrate flexibility to work beyond standard hours when required.
  • Apply strong problem-solving skills to identify causes and develop solutions.
Key Requirements
  • Valid Driver’s License (Code 10 + PDP).
  • Tertiary Qualification in Construction Project Management / or similar
  • 2–4 years’ experience in a similar construction management role.
  • Strong knowledge of construction processes, materials, and equipment.
  • Proficiency in reading and interpreting building plans.
  • Hands-on approach with excellent leadership and time-management skills.
  • Strong communication skills (bilingual advantageous).
  • Ability to resolve conflicts fairly and maintain a collaborative team environment.
  • Knowledge of safety codes and compliance requirements.
  • Motivated, detail-oriented, and passionate about construction.
What’s on Offer
  • Annual Package: R250 000 (CTC) – negotiable, payable monthly.
  • Accommodation provided: 2-bedroom unit with lounge, kitchen, porch, water & electricity (unfurnished).
  • Company Vehicle for work-related responsibilities.
  • Uniform provided annually.
  • Work Schedule: Monday to Friday (weekends & public holidays off, unless required).
  • Annual Leave: 15 days after 1 year of service, aligned with company’s December/January shutdown.
  • Bed Night Scheme after 1 year of service (terms & conditions apply).
  • Pension Fund Contribution (includes disability, dread disease, life insurance, and funeral cover).
